Всичко за хеширането 

Всичко, което трябва да знаете за хеширането
#заглавие_на_изображение

В днешния дигитален свят сигурността на данните е основна грижа за хората и организациите. От защитата с парола до целостта на данните, от съществено значение е да има стабилни механизми, които да гарантират поверителността и автентичността на чувствителната информация. Тук се намесва хеширането.

Хеширането, основна криптографска техника, предлага a мощна корекция за необратимо осигуряване на данните.

В тази статия ще се потопим в детайлите на хеширането, изследвайки как работи, приложенията му и значението му в пейзажа на ИТ сигурността.

Вземете 200% бонус след първия си депозит. Използвайте този промо код: argent2035

🚀 Какво е хашиш? 

Хешът, с прости думи, е математическа трансформация, която взема данни с променлив размер и ги преобразува в уникален цифров пръстов отпечатък с фиксиран размер. Този отпечатък, често наричан „хашиш“, е криптографски сборник, който обобщава всички данни с необратим произход.

С други думи, на практика е невъзможно да се реконструират оригиналните данни от хеша, което прави хеширането основна еднопосочна техника за осигуряване на поверителност и цялост на информацията. 

Едно от най-честите приложения на хеширането е проверка на целостта на даннитес. Чрез изчисляване на пръстовия отпечатък на файл или набор от данни става възможно да се открие всяка промяна или модификация на данните.

Дори незначителна промяна в оригиналните данни ще доведе до напълно различен пръстов отпечатък, което улеснява бързото идентифициране на грешки или опити за манипулации. 

БукмейкърипремияЗаложете сега
ТАЙНА 1XBET✔️ премия : до €1950 + 150 безплатни завъртания
💸 Широка гама от игри на слот машини
🎁 Промо код : argent2035
✔️премия : до €1500 + 150 безплатни завъртания
💸 Широка гама от казино игри
🎁 Промо код : argent2035
✔️ Бонус: до 1750 € + 290 CHF
💸 Портфолио от първокласни казина
🎁 Промо код : 200euros

Хешът намира своето място и в областта на криптографията, предлагайки a силна защита с парола и чувствителна информация. Вместо да съхраняват пароли директно в база данни, защитените системи ги хешират, преди да ги съхранят.

Когато потребителят въведе своята парола, тя отново се хешира и сравнява със съхранената стойност за проверка. По този начин, дори и в случай на неоторизиран достъп до базата данни, паролите остават неразшифровани.

 Въпреки това, не всички хеширащи алгоритми са създадени еднакви. Някои се считат за остарели или уязвими за напреднали криптографски атаки.

Експертите по сигурността препоръчват използването на стабилни и добре установени алгоритми, като SHA-256 или SHA-512, за да се осигури оптимална сигурност.

 🚀Защо хешът?

Важно е да използвате хеша, за да можете да защитите транзакциите, които вече са извършени, както и тези, които предстоят.

След като бъде направена модификация в мрежата, ще трябва абсолютно да модифицирате всички предишни блокове, както и свързаните с тях хешове. Ако направим модификация в цялата мрежа, хешът, който ще бъде генериран, ще бъде ваш.

Статия за четене: Всичко за заповедта

Ще трябва да сравните своя хеш, както и този на мрежата, за да не валидирате транзакция.

Наистина, хешът е един от основните елементи за конституирането на дърво на Markel. Следователно е възможно някои криптовалути да комбинират няколко хеш функции, които имат различни свойства от другите.

🚀Правилата и свойствата на хеширането

За да бъде правилна хеш функцията, тя трябва да спазва определени правила и свойства:

  • Дължината на подписа използвани трябва винаги да е едно и също, без значение колко данни сте въвели. По-късно ще видим какви са дължините на пръстовите отпечатъци в хеш функциите.
  • От пръстови отпечатъци, невъзможно е да се намерят оригиналните данни: функциите в хеша работят само в една посока.
  • Не е възможно да се предвиди подпис. Невъзможно е да се опитате да си представите подписа, като изследвате данните.
  • Ако имате множество данни, всяка от тях трябва имат различни подписи.

🚀Как работи хеширането

В действителност хеширането е автоматизиран процес, който има потенциала да бъде оприличен на кодовете, които се изпращат по време на война.

На теория е просто необходимо да добавите, изместите или трансформирате различните символи на едно съобщение, за да получите код, който трябва да бъде напълно различен от другите и уникален по рода си.

Статия за четене: Вземете групово финансиране за вашия проект

Хешът ви позволява да генерирате от променлив допълнителен вход, фиксиран код. Дори ако дължината на низа е повече от 5 букви или дори 500 думи, той пак трябва да върне само резултат с един размер.

Всички хеш функции съдържат едни и същи свойства. Които са :

БукмейкърипремияЗаложете сега
✔️ премия : до €1950 + 150 безплатни завъртания
💸 Широка гама от игри на слот машини
🎁 Промо код : 200euros
✔️премия : до €1500 + 150 безплатни завъртания
💸 Широка гама от казино игри
🎁 Промо код : 200euros
ТАЙНА 1XBET✔️ премия : до €1950 + 150 безплатни завъртания
💸 Широка гама от игри на слот машини
🎁 Промо код : WULLI
  • Детерминист : директно, след преминаване през мелницата на въпросната функция, резултатът от съобщението, при всички обстоятелства, трябва да бъде непроменлив: места, момент, повторение, …
  • La съпротивление : резултатът, получен от функцията, не трябва да позволява на никого по всяко време да се върне към първоначалното съобщение.
  • отчетлив : резултатът, получен от функцията относно две подобни съобщения, не трябва да бъде подобен, а по-скоро различен и лесно разпознаваем.
  • Уникална : след анализ две различни съобщения не могат да излязат с еднакъв резултат.
  • Ефективно : резултатът не трябва да закъснява, трябва да е незабавен.

Следователно интересът на хеширането е да стандартизира съдържанието, за да има идентичен брой знаци и да може да идентифицира данните по уникален начин за едно съобщение към друго.

🚀Практическо използване на различни хеш функции

Този списък изобщо не е пълен, тъй като има няколко други приложения на тези функции:

  • Сравнение между пароли : както казах, когато запазвате паролата си, всичко се прави за сигурност.
  • Проверка на вашите изтеглени данни : в някои случаи например, когато изтеглите файл от интернет, оригиналният подпис на файла е наличен.

То се показва директно на сайта или в друг файл, който е отделен. За да сте сигурни, че файлът е изтеглен правилно, просто трябва да проверите дали подписът на файла наистина съвпада с предоставения.

  • Цифров или електронен подпис на документиs: тук документите се изпращат директно към хеш функция. Документите се изпращат едновременно с пръстовите отпечатъци. Потребителят трябва само да дешифрира получения пръстов отпечатък и да провери дали той съответства на изчислението на пръстовия отпечатък, прикрепен към получените данни.
  • Използване на хеш таблица : ако искате да го направите, ще трябва да го използвате в разработката на софтуер, за да може всичко да върви добре.
  • Относно съхранението на данни : за да сте сигурни в наличието на документа, ще трябва да се уверите, че подписът също е там, така че не е необходимо да го запазвате отново. Това е много ценно, защото ако това е файл, който е голям, ще ви отнеме много по-малко време, за да се направи изчисляването на подписа на регистрирания пръстов отпечатък.

🚀Използване на хеш кодиране

Функцията, която пази вашите пароли защитени, е тази, която взема текста на вашата парола и го смила в подпис. Този подпис също се нарича отпечатък ".

Компютърът не изпраща вашата парола на сървър, той предава само вашия подпис на паролата. В този момент сървърът не запазва паролата, а по-скоро подписа, който е бил смлян.

Статия за четене: Как да залагате на ТВ игри на живо в 1xbet 

Вземете 200% бонус след първия си депозит. Използвайте този официален промо код: argent2035

Когато компютърът се свърже, сървърът няма да провери самоличността на вашата парола, а по-скоро дали подписът на вашата парола е същият като регистрираната.

Така че не се притеснявайте, че някой ще използва вашата парола, защото функцията за хеширане намалява риска от трафик с парола.

🚀Известни хеш функции

Сега ще ви представим някои известни функции и някои сайтове, които ви помагат.

⚡️MD5

Със сигурност някои хора вече са чували за него. Тази хеш функция се използва много добре и още повече от гледна точка на сигурността е препоръчително да преминете към най-стабилната налична версия, тъй като последствията от сблъсъци са налице.

Статия за четене: Управлявайте добре бизнес акаунтите си 

Имайте предвид, че тази функция директно връща 128-битов хеш.

⚡️SHA1

SHA1 преди беше заместващата функция на MD5, защото изпрати 160-битови хешове и не даде шанс да се натъкнете на сблъсъци.

БукмейкърипремияЗаложете сега
✔️ премия : до €750 + 150 безплатни завъртания
💸 Широка гама от игри на слот машини
🎁 Промо код : 200euros
???? Cryptos: bitcoin, Dogecoin, etheureum, USDT
✔️премия : до €2000 + 150 безплатни завъртания
💸 Широка гама от казино игри
🎁 Cryptos: bitcoin, Dogecoin, etheureum, USDT
✔️ Бонус: до 1750 € + 290 CHF
💸 Топ крипто казина
🎁 Cryptos: bitcoin, Dogecoin, etheureum, USDT

Това се промени от 2004-2005 г., когато няколко атаки показаха възможностите за генериране на сблъсъци.

От тази дата не е препоръчително да използвате тази функция на SHA1. Но днес много хора все още използват тази функция.

От 31 декември 2016 г. цифровите сертификати, които използват SHA1, вече не са валидни.

⚡️SHA2

Се състои от SHA256 et SHA512, те са двата най-големи стандарта, които се използват в момента.

Казваме това със сигурност, защото все още не сме открили уязвимости в сигурността на тези различни функции. Имат възможност за производство на подписи във височина респ 256 и 512 бита.

И накрая, ще ви запознаем с някои сайтове, които ви дават възможност за генериране на цифрови подписи с файлове или данни, както и използване на различни хеш функции.

  • Ако искате да шифровате текст, имате: http://www.cryptage-md5.com/
  • За да шифровате на английски: http://onlinemd5.com/

Не забравяйте да ги използвате добре, за да се възползвате от техните функции.

🚀Извод

Хешът е повече от просто математическа функция. Това е мощен инструмент в областта на компютърната сигурност. В тази статия проучихме основите на хеширането и неговата уместност в днешния дигитален пейзаж. 

Научихме, че хеширането осигурява ефективен метод за проверка на целостта на данните, откриване на подправяне или грешки. Освен това, той играе жизненоважна роля в защитата на паролите, като ги прави неразбиваеми и по този начин защитава чувствителната информация. 

Статия за четене: Как да финансирате проекта си с ограничен бюджет?

Освен тези обичайни употреби, открихме и многобройните приложения на хеширането в различни области на изчислителната техника. Независимо дали за съхранение на данни, дедупликация, хеш таблици или извличане на информация, хеширането се оказва универсален и ефективен инструмент. 

Въпреки това е от решаващо значение алгоритъмът за хеширане да бъде избран внимателно според конкретните нужди. текущи стандарти, като SHA-256 или SHA-512, осигуряват по-високи нива на сигурност и трябва да се предпочитат пред остарелите или уязвими алгоритми. 

често задавани въпроси

⚡️За какво използваме хеш?

Интересното в хеша в никакъв случай не са въпросните данни, а по-скоро техните подписи, които позволяват добро ниво на сигурност на данните.

⚡️Какво е хеш колизия?

Сблъсък се представя, когато няколко различни данни една от друга дават един и същ пръстов отпечатък. Но не се притеснявайте, ако това се случи, защото е само въпрос на проста проверка дали пръстовият отпечатък, който сме получили за данните, е същият като този на изпратените данни.

Ние свършихме !!

 Надяваме се, че сте останали доволни и хеш функциите нямат повече тайни за вас.

Оставете коментар

Вашият имейл адрес няма да бъде публикуван. Задължителните полета са маркирани *

*